Beauty herself shall write the raptured word
That’s worth the maid remembered up till now
To celebrate what seems to sullen souls absurd
A mad romance beyond a faithful vow
What’s there to see except an older fool
A man who moans and miaows in maudlin moods
He’d aim at quondam dreams all doomed to pule
And lament lonesome hearts that love eludes
A wiser man would mock those whims away
For after all there’s nothing new you know
A love you pray, a love to stay, a love astray
We’re all so close to bliss but learn to grow
Or so they say, the hearts that feed a ghoul
They laugh at love, at me, with jaded joys
But I rebuke their rants that ridicule
A sad romance their failing faith destroys
Leave him to write while beauty’s still allowed
A time will come indeed when love’s denied
A face to praise aloud, the grace to bless the crowd
The end of times when He is crucified
